How Polo Shirts Transformed From Sportswear to Style Essential
Polo shirts have progressed from their emergence in the athletic context to become a foundation of contemporary fashion. Initially fashioned for tennis and polo players in the late 19th century, these shirts were noted by their airy textile and striking collar. The movement from sportswear to everyday apparel began in the mid-20th century when celebrities and style icons took to them as casual wear. This trend was further promoted by brands that blended lively shades and designs, engaging a broader audience.
The adaptability of the polo shirt has enabled it to seamlessly blend into various fashion contexts, from casual weekends to business-casual environments. Its ability to communicate both ease and sophistication has established its status in men's wardrobes. Today, polos are not merely functional; they are a statement of personal style, showcasing the wearer's identity and adaptability in an ever-changing fashion landscape.

What Fabrics Are Trending in Modern Polos?
The advancement of contemporary polos copyrights markedly on material selection, which are essential role to their comfort and style. Modern creations are progressively manufactured from performance materials including polyester blends engineered for moisture-wicking, offering comfort and breathability in hot climates. Such fabrics facilitate peak movement, rendering them perfect for both everyday occasions and athletic activities.
Cotton persists as a conventional option, often integrated with spandex to boost flexibility and fit. This mixture provides a soft touch while making sure that the polo preserves its shape. Green fabrics, such as organic cotton and recycled polyester, are also picking up momentum, showing a growing consumer inclination for sustainable fashion.
Moreover, textured fabrics like pique and jersey are sought after, lending depth and decorative charm to the garment. Together, these fashionable fabrics are reimagining the polo shirt, uniting functionality with modern aesthetics in a multifaceted wardrobe cornerstone.
Tailored vs. Relaxed Fits: Which Polo Style Suits You?
Selecting the best fit in polo shirts can greatly affect both wearability and style. Tailored fits provide a sleek, contemporary silhouette that emphasizes the body’s shape. This style is suited for formal occasions or business casual settings, where a clean appearance is needed. Tailored polos usually have a tighter cut, delivering a refined vibe that pairs well with dressier clothing.
Conversely, relaxed fits stress comfort, facilitating ease of movement. These polos are wonderful for relaxed gatherings and weekend wear, imparting a casual impression without compromising style. The roomier design enables layer wearing and is suitable for various body types.
Ultimately, the decision between tailored and relaxed fits relies on individual preferences and the planned purpose of the polo. By evaluating individual aesthetic and event, one can choose the fit that best enhances their clothing collection while ensuring comfort.

What procedures should I follow to correctly care for my Polo garments?
To adequately maintain polo shirts, one should wash them in cold water, steer clear of bleach, and tumble dry using low temperature. Press on a low temperature if needed, making sure to review labels for specific care instructions.
